On 2014-01-01 the FDA classified a Class II recall of Indus Invue Screws: IM71058-XX: 04.2mm, SelfTapping, Tapered by Spinefrontier, citing mismarked and unmarked screws.

Product
Indus Invue Screws: IM71058-XX: 04.2mm, SelfTapping, Tapered. Used to secure the Invue Anterior Cervical Plate in position.
Reason
Mismarked and unmarked screws
